In the meantime, here are some initial things to check:
1. Confirm with your bank that the phone number registered with your account is correct and active. Sometimes banks require you to opt-in to receive verification codes like OTPs (one-time passwords).
2. Make sure your iPhone has a stable internet connection, either via Wi-Fi or mobile data, as this is crucial for the app to communicate with your bank's servers.
3. Try restarting your iPhone to refresh any temporary glitches.
4. If the app is installed, check if there is an update available in the App Store. Updating the app can often resolve connection issues.
5. If the app uses SMS for verification, verify that your phone can receive texts from unknown numbers and that no SMS-blocking features are active.
If these basics check out but the problem remains, we can proceed with clearing app cache (though iOS doesn’t have a straightforward cache clear option, reinstalling the app works similarly) or checking if the bank has any known outages.
